Veterans and service dogs: Legion commits significant funds

The Legion’s Ontario Command, its Branches, and Ladies’ Auxiliaries have made a crucial donation to Wounded Warriors Canada (WWC) to help continue its work to pair more Veterans with life-changing service dogs. These exceptional dogs are trained to help reduce Veteran anxiety in public settings, redirect attention to more positive activities, help with nightmare interruption and in stabilizing sleep patterns.

30th Anniversary of the end of the Gulf War - Veterans Affairs Canada

28 February 2021 marks the 30th anniversary of the end of the Gulf War. After Iraq invaded Kuwait, Canada joined a coalition of more than 35 countries to help liberate the small Gulf nation. More than 4,000 Canadians served in the Gulf War.

Final phase of $14M federal support fund rolls out to Branches

  05/07/2021

The last of the funding allocated to The Royal Canadian Legion by Veterans Affairs Canada was disbursed this week. In the third and final distribution phase, 885 Branches shared the remaining $3.8 million. Read More 

Branch 605 Receives Funds

Dec. 2020: Our Branch 605 was the grateful recipient of $10,845.05 of Federal support dollars.  These funds will assist with our operating expenses during the pandemic.  Thank you to  the Federal Government, Veterans Affairs Canada and Dominion Command.
